What is Metabolism? At its core, metabolism is the sum of all chemical processes that occur in your body to maintain life. Think of it as your body's internal engine. This engine burns calories from the food you eat to fuel everything you do, from breathing and thinking to exercising and even sleeping. The speed at which this engine runs is your metabolic rate. A higher metabolic rate means your body burns more calories at rest and during activity. Conversely, a lower metabolic rate means fewer calories are burned. This directly impacts your ability to lose weight, maintain a healthy weight, and perform well during physical activities. What is Metabolic Testing? Metabolic testing is a way to measure how efficiently your body burns calories and uses oxygen. It provides a personalized snapshot of your unique metabolic function. These tests are designed to give you valuable insights into your body's energy expenditure, helping you make informed decisions about your diet and exercise routine. The information gathered can be incredibly useful for tailoring weight loss plans, optimizing fitness routines, and understanding why you might be experiencing weight plateaus or fatigue during workouts. Key Components of Metabolic Testing Metabolic testing typically involves several different assessments, each revealing a crucial aspect of your metabolism: Resting Metabolic Rate (RMR): This test estimates the number of calories your body burns while completely at rest – no exercise, no movement. It's the baseline energy your body needs just to function. Knowing your RMR helps determine your daily calorie needs more accurately. Maximum Volume of Oxygen (VO2 Max): Also known as aerobic capacity, this test measures how effectively your body uses oxygen during exercise. A higher VO2 Max generally indicates better cardiovascular fitness and endurance. It tells us how well your heart, lungs, and muscles work together to deliver and utilize oxygen during physical exertion. Lactate Threshold Test: This test identifies the point during exercise where lactic acid begins to build up in your blood faster than it can be cleared. Pushing past your lactate threshold leads to muscle fatigue and a burning sensation. Understanding this point helps in designing training zones for endurance athletes and optimizing workout intensity for general fitness. Thermic Effect of Food (TEF): While not always part of a standard metabolic test, understanding TEF is important. TEF is the energy your body uses to digest, absorb, and metabolize the food you eat. Certain foods, like protein, can increase TEF, meaning your body burns more calories processing them. How is Metabolic Testing Performed? Metabolic testing can be conducted in various settings, from medical facilities and specialized fitness centers to even at home, though the methods and accuracy can differ. In a Medical Facility or Fitness Center: These are the most common and comprehensive settings for metabolic testing. The equipment and procedures might vary slightly, but the core principles remain the same. Calorimetry Test (for RMR): This is often the first part of the test and is performed while you are lying down, completely still. You might breathe into a mouthpiece connected to a monitor, or rest under a plastic hood. The test measures the oxygen you consume and the carbon dioxide you exhale. By analyzing these gases, the equipment can estimate how many calories your body burns at rest. VO2 Max Test: This is typically done while you perform an aerobic activity, such as walking or running on a treadmill, or cycling on a stationary bike. You will wear a mask that measures your oxygen intake and carbon dioxide output as the intensity of the exercise gradually increases. The test continues until you reach your maximum capacity or can no longer continue. The duration depends on your current fitness level. Lactate Threshold Test: This often accompanies the VO2 Max test. During the exercise, small blood samples are taken periodically to measure lactate levels, or a specialized mask might be used to estimate lactate buildup based on your breathing patterns. Analysis of Results: After the tests, your healthcare provider or certified trainer analyzes the data using specific formulas. This analysis provides estimates of your RMR, VO2 Max, and lactate threshold, giving a clear picture of your metabolic health and fitness level. At-Home Testing: At-home metabolism tests are also available. These kits typically involve sending a saliva or blood sample to a lab. They often focus on measuring hormone levels that can influence metabolism, such as thyroid hormones (like T3) and cortisol. While these tests can offer insights into hormonal balance, they do not directly measure metabolic rate or oxygen consumption like clinical tests do. They provide a different, but potentially complementary, piece of information. Choosing a Testing Facility: If you're considering metabolic testing, it's wise to consult your doctor. They can recommend reliable testing facilities in your area. It's important to note that metabolic testing can be expensive, and insurance coverage varies, so inquire about costs beforehand. What Do the Results Mean for Weight Loss and Fitness? Metabolic testing results are not just numbers; they are powerful tools that can guide your health journey. For Weight Loss: Knowing your RMR helps you understand the minimum calories your body needs daily. This allows you to create a calorie deficit for weight loss that is sustainable and doesn't starve your body. For instance, if your RMR is lower than average, you might need to be more mindful of portion sizes and choose nutrient-dense foods. If your RMR is higher, you might have a bit more flexibility, but balanced nutrition remains key. Scenario: Priya, a 35-year-old homemaker from Delhi, found it incredibly hard to lose the 10 kgs she gained after her second child. Despite cutting down on sweets and trying to walk daily, the scale barely budged. Her metabolic test revealed a lower-than-expected RMR. Armed with this information, she worked with a nutritionist to create a meal plan focusing on high-protein meals and increased her daily activity with simple home exercises, leading to gradual and steady weight loss. For Fitness: Your VO2 Max score indicates your cardiovascular fitness. A higher score means your body is more efficient at delivering oxygen to your muscles, which translates to better endurance and performance during activities like running, swimming, or cycling. This information can help you set realistic fitness goals and track your progress. The lactate threshold helps in determining optimal training intensities. Pushing yourself just below your lactate threshold for sustained periods can improve your endurance without excessive fatigue. Factors Influencing Your Metabolism It's essential to remember that your metabolic rate isn't fixed. Several factors influence how fast or slow it runs: Age: Metabolism naturally tends to slow down as we age. Gender: Men generally have a higher metabolic rate than women due to having more muscle mass. Body Composition: Muscle burns more calories than fat, even at rest. So, a higher muscle mass means a faster metabolism. Genetics: Your genes play a role in determining your baseline metabolic rate. Physical Activity Level: The more active you are, the more calories you burn, and regular exercise can boost your metabolism over time. Diet: What you eat and how you eat matters. A diet rich in protein can increase the thermic effect of food. Staying hydrated by drinking enough water has also been shown to boost metabolic rate. Hormones: Hormones like thyroid hormones are critical regulators of metabolism. Imbalances can significantly affect metabolic rate. Can Metabolic Testing Help You Lose Weight?
